Transaction 078a2282f92962a80ab351845c7524c69d0b044fcb01cdaa56dc8e71cea3df3e

7 Input
2 Outputs
  • 078a2282f92962a80ab351845c7524c69d0b044fcb01cdaa56dc8e71cea3df3e:0
  • value  1000096
    address  37MuBvwGdgsMDduj2fgs84vcesD49Ytfij
  • 078a2282f92962a80ab351845c7524c69d0b044fcb01cdaa56dc8e71cea3df3e:1
  • value  1643757
    address  3KAhPiyn8XWAVAsix4RryD7USgPGnvuAAS